As a Scheduling professional on our award-winning program management team, you will support the execution of various capital improvement programs. You will apply your skills in scheduling, reporting, cost controls, communications, and problem-solving in a fast-paced, professional design and construction environment.
Your work will directly contribute to bringing transformational project solutions to life. Under the guidance of the program manager and/or program director, you will interface with stakeholders, clients, contractors, and consultants to ensure alignment with program milestones. This role is designed for those who care deeply about seeing work through from concept to completion, offering a rewarding opportunity to manage complex schedules and drive project success.
